Iron Oxide Powder vs Other Pigments: Key Differences Explained

Aug,05,2026

Selecting the right colorant for concrete, coatings, or plastics comes down to one question: which pigment holds its color longest under real-world stress. Iron Oxide Powder has earned its place as a go-to inorganic pigment because it resists sunlight, alkali, and temperature swings far better than many alternatives, while staying priced for high-volume production.

01 What Sets Iron Oxide Powder Apart

Iron oxide powder is a mineral-based pigment available in red, yellow, black, brown, and orange shades. Its molecular structure is chemically stable under UV exposure and alkaline conditions, which is why it dominates cement, paving block, roof tile, and architectural coating production. Independent weathering panels routinely show under 3 percent color shift after five years of outdoor exposure, a benchmark few organic colorants can match.

02 Iron Oxide Powder vs Organic Pigments

Organic pigments deliver punchier, more saturated shades and are common in printing inks and decorative coatings. What they trade away is weather resistance: many organic colorants fade or chalk within two to three years of direct sun exposure, especially in warm climates.

Mineral Pigment

  • Chemically stable in alkaline cement
  • Very high UV and heat resistance
  • Lower raw material cost
  • Moderate color brightness

Organic Pigment

  • Brighter, more vivid shades
  • Wider available color range
  • Variable weather performance
  • Higher unit cost

03 Iron Oxide vs Titanium Dioxide and Carbon Black

Titanium dioxide is the industry standard for whitening and opacity, while carbon black delivers deep black tone and reinforcement in rubber compounds. Neither replaces iron oxide for red, yellow, or brown tones, and formulators frequently blend all three to hit a target shade.

Pigment Primary Role Best Fit
Iron Oxide Powder Color (red, yellow, black, brown) Concrete, coatings, plastics, ceramics
Titanium Dioxide Whitening and opacity Paints, plastics, paper
Carbon Black Deep black, reinforcement Tires, rubber, black plastics

04 Where Iron Oxide Powder Wins on Durability

For anything installed outdoors, alkali and UV resistance matter more than initial brightness. Iron oxide powder holds its position at the top of that list alongside titanium dioxide, while ultramarine and many organic pigments fall behind once alkali exposure enters the picture. This is the deciding factor for concrete producers, paving manufacturers, and coating formulators who cannot afford re-application cycles.

05 How to Choose the Right Pigment

  • 1
    Application environment — outdoor products need UV and alkali resistance first.
  • 2
    Color requirements — match required intensity against available shade range.
  • 3
    Material compatibility — confirm performance in cement, plastic, rubber, or ceramic bodies.
  • 4
    Budget at volume — mineral pigments scale more affordably for high-tonnage production.

Frequently Asked Questions

Is iron oxide powder safe for use in cement and concrete?

Yes. Iron oxide powder is chemically inert in alkaline cement environments, which is precisely why it remains the standard colorant for concrete pavers, roof tiles, and precast products.

Can iron oxide powder match the brightness of organic pigments?

Not fully. Organic pigments generally reach brighter, more saturated shades, but iron oxide compensates with far superior long-term weather stability and lower cost per ton.

Should titanium dioxide and iron oxide be used together?

Frequently, yes. Titanium dioxide handles opacity and whitening while iron oxide supplies the red, yellow, brown, or black tone, and combining them is standard practice in coating and plastics formulation.

What determines the price difference between pigment types?

Raw material sourcing, production complexity, and brightness level drive cost. Mineral pigments like iron oxide are mined and processed at scale, keeping unit cost well below many synthetic organic colorants.

Across construction, coatings, plastics, and ceramics, Iron Oxide Powder remains the most balanced choice when a project needs durability, chemical stability, and cost control at the same time — with titanium dioxide, carbon black, and organic pigments filling in for the roles iron oxide was never designed to play.
